二进制转为十进制的短除法原理
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
二进制转为十进制的短除法原理
文章主题:探索二进制转为十进制的短除法原理
在数学领域中,我们经常会遇到不同进制之间的转换问题。
其中,二进制和十进制的转换是最为常见的一种。
而在二进制转为十进制的过程中,短除法原理是最基础、最常用的方法之一。
本文将深入探讨短除法原理,并以从简到繁的方式呈现,帮助读者更深入地理解这一数学原理。
1. 二进制与十进制的概念梳理
让我们简要回顾一下二进制和十进制的概念。
在日常生活中,我们所使用的数字系统是十进制,即基数为10。
而二进制则是计算机中常用的数字系统,其基数为2。
在十进制中,每个位置上的数字代表的是相应的10的幂;而在二进制中,每个位置上的数字代表的是2的幂。
在十进制中,123的含义是1*10^2 + 2*10^1 + 3*10^0;而在二进制中,101的含义是1*2^2 + 0*2^1 + 1*2^0。
2. 二进制转为十进制的短除法原理
接下来,让我们深入短除法原理。
当我们需要将一个二进制数转换为十进制时,短除法是一种简单而有效的方法。
其基本原理是从二进制数的最右边开始,将每一位的数与相应的2的幂相乘,然后将结果相
加即可得到十进制数值。
举个例子来说,对于二进制数1101,我们可以按照如下步骤进行短除法转换:
1. 从最右边的1开始,对应的2的幂为2^0,所以该位的值为
1*2^0=1;
2. 接着向左移动一位,对应的2的幂为2^1,所以该位的值为
0*2^1=0;
3. 再向左移动一位,对应的2的幂为2^2,所以该位的值为
1*2^2=4;
4. 最后向左移动一位,对应的2的幂为2^3,所以该位的值为
1*2^3=8。
将上述步骤计算结果相加,即可得到1101转换为十进制的结果为
1+0+4+8=13。
3. 示例分析与进一步探讨
通过以上简单的示例,我们可以清晰地看到短除法原理在二进制转为
十进制的过程中的应用。
但在实际应用中,可能会遇到一些特殊情况,比如负数、小数以及较大位数的二进制数转换等问题。
针对这些情况,我们可能需要进一步讨论短除法的适用性、改进方法以及注意事项等
内容。
在实际的工程中,例如计算机系统中的数据存储与运算,二进制转为
十进制的问题可能会涉及到一些高级的数学知识和算法。
此时,我们可能需要借助其他数学原理,如对数、幂运算等,来更为准确地完成二进制到十进制的转换操作。
4. 个人观点与总结
作为一种重要的数学原理,短除法在二进制与十进制之间的转换中发挥着重要作用。
它简单而直观,适用于大多数情况。
然而,我们也应该意识到,在特殊情况下,短除法可能不再适用,或者需要结合其他数学知识来进行优化处理。
在实际应用中,我们需要根据具体情况灵活运用短除法,并不断学习、积累相关的数学知识,以便更好地完成转换工作。
通过本文的深入探讨,相信读者对短除法原理在二进制转为十进制的过程中有了更为清晰的理解。
我们可以依托此基础,进一步学习和探讨数学领域中更多的知识,拓展我们的数学视野,为实际应用中的问题解决提供更多的思路和方法。
结语
通过这篇文章,我们对二进制转为十进制的短除法原理有了全面的了解。
在接下来的学习与应用过程中,我们可以根据实际需求进一步拓展知识,完善自己的数学技能。
希望本文能够为读者带来帮助,也欢迎大家对短除法原理进行更深入的讨论与探索。
在现代社会中,数学不仅仅是一门学科,更是一个重要的工具。
而在数学领域中,我们经
常会遇到不同进制之间的转换问题。
其中,二进制和十进制的转换是
最为常见的一种。
而在二进制转为十进制的过程中,短除法是最基础、最常用的方法之一。
本文将深入探讨短除法原理,并以从简到繁的方
式呈现,帮助读者更深入地理解这一数学原理。
让我们简要回顾一下二进制和十进制的概念。
在日常生活中,我们所
使用的数字系统是十进制,即基数为10。
而二进制则是计算机中常用的数字系统,其基数为2。
在十进制中,每个位置上的数字代表的是相应的10的幂;而在二进制中,每个位置上的数字代表的是2的幂。
在十进制中,123的含义是1*10^2 + 2*10^1 + 3*10^0;而在二进制中,101的含义是1*2^2 + 0*2^1 + 1*2^0。
当我们需要将一个二进制数转换为十进制时,短除法是一种简单而有
效的方法。
其基本原理是从二进制数的最右边开始,将每一位的数与
相应的2的幂相乘,然后将结果相加即可得到十进制数值。
举个例子来说,对于二进制数1101,我们可以按照如下步骤进行短除法转换:
1. 从最右边的1开始,对应的2的幂为2^0,所以该位的值为
1*2^0=1;
2. 接着向左移动一位,对应的2的幂为2^1,所以该位的值为
0*2^1=0;
3. 再向左移动一位,对应的2的幂为2^2,所以该位的值为
1*2^2=4;
4. 最后向左移动一位,对应的2的幂为2^3,所以该位的值为
1*2^3=8。
将上述步骤计算结果相加,即可得到1101转换为十进制的结果为
1+0+4+8=13。
通过这个简单的示例,我们可以清晰地看到短除法原理在二进制转为
十进制的过程中的应用。
但在实际应用中,可能会遇到一些特殊情况,比如负数、小数以及较大位数的二进制数转换等问题。
针对这些情况,我们可能需要进一步讨论短除法的适用性、改进方法以及注意事项等
内容。
在实际的工程中,例如计算机系统中的数据存储与运算,二进制转为
十进制的问题可能会涉及到一些高级的数学知识和算法。
此时,我们
可能需要借助其他数学原理,如对数、幂运算等,来更为准确地完成
二进制到十进制的转换操作。
作为一种重要的数学原理,短除法在二进制与十进制之间的转换中发
挥着重要作用。
它简单而直观,适用于大多数情况。
然而,我们也应
该意识到,在特殊情况下,短除法可能不再适用,或者需要结合其他
数学知识来进行优化处理。
在实际应用中,我们需要根据具体情况灵
活运用短除法,并不断学习、积累相关的数学知识,以便更好地完成转换工作。
通过这篇文章,我们对二进制转为十进制的短除法原理有了全面的了解。
在接下来的学习与应用过程中,我们可以根据实际需求进一步拓展知识,完善自己的数学技能。
希望本文能够为读者带来帮助,也欢迎大家对短除法原理进行更深入的讨论与探索。
在现代社会,在数学领域中,不断探索和学习新的数学知识是十分重要的。
我建议我们在日常生活中多多思考,多多学习,不断提高自己的数学水平。
愿大家都能够在数学领域中茁壮成长,为社会发展做出贡献。